Q. Is laterite stone environmentally friendly?
Answer
It is the obligation of those working in the construction industry to guarantee that the laterite stone being used is sustainable and does not harm the environment. Laterite, sometimes known as "green" or ecologically friendly construction materials, is easily recyclable, requires a low amount of energy during manufacture, and is non-toxic both in its uses and in the production process. The goal of sustainable development is to raise the overall quality of life while simultaneously protecting the natural environment and meeting the demands of the future. These intertwined goals are more likely to be accomplished if the demand for material resources is managed intelligently, and if the management of construction waste is carried out correctly.
